More than a traditional IVR
A conventional IVR usually moves callers through fixed menu options. A voice AI agent can interpret natural language, maintain conversation context and follow a workflow based on what the customer says.

A voice agent can become the first response to a local enquiry.
Consider a diagnostic centre receiving calls from patients across Rewa and nearby areas. Staff may repeatedly answer questions about tests, appointment availability, operating information and preparation requirements.
A voice agent can handle the first layer of those conversations, identify what the caller needs, collect relevant details and route the enquiry according to the centre's rules. When a question requires medical or staff judgement, the workflow can move the caller toward a human team member rather than attempting to answer beyond the approved information.
The same principle can apply to an education business around University Road: instead of every staff member repeatedly explaining course options, the voice agent can gather a student's preferred course, timing and contact details before a counsellor follows up.

Voice AI Agent questions, answered clearly.
A Voice AI Agent is an AI-powered system that can communicate with customers over a phone call using natural conversation. Unlike a traditional IVR that mainly asks callers to press numbers, a voice agent can understand spoken questions, respond according to business information, collect details and perform defined actions. For example, a Rewa diagnostic centre could use a voice agent to answer questions about available tests, operating hours and appointment requests. A coaching institute could use it to ask prospective students which course they are interested in, capture their contact details and arrange a follow-up. A properly designed agent can also recognise when a conversation needs human attention and transfer or escalate the interaction according to predefined rules.

The timeline depends on the scope. A straightforward agent with a focused set of FAQs and lead-capture tasks can be prepared much faster than a complex solution involving CRM integration, appointment systems, multiple departments and extensive call handling rules. Troika Tech begins by mapping the required conversations and business information. We then create the dialogue flows, configure the knowledge and actions, connect the required systems, test common and unusual scenarios, and launch after quality checks. Testing is important because real customers do not always follow a prepared script. The agent should be evaluated for misunderstandings, incomplete information, interruptions, language switching, escalation requirements and other realistic call situations before wider deployment.
